Transaction 5f90658f2520a75e452c6218b954df394e5f06c8113468860d524a30ece28d30
1 Input
1 Output
-
5f90658f2520a75e452c6218b954df394e5f06c8113468860d524a30ece28d30:0
- value
- 811461
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4d80633131dddb0aeaf63e4a70c37b9559c7697d8e2fc9ef34893697c518764b
- address
- bc1pfkqxxvf3mhds46hk8e98psmmj4vuw6ta3chunme53ymf03gcwe9su6k7dk